Everyone’s talking about AI voice agents that can answer calls, talk naturally, and even replace human call-centre staff — but are they actually worth it? In this video, we’ll explore how Azure OpenAI Realtime models and Azure Communication Services work together to build powerful voice agents for real businesses. You’ll see how these AI agents handle inbound and outbound calls, manage interruptions, sound human-like, and even perform real actions such as booking appointments or logging CRM tickets. We’ll also discuss key points every business needs to know: ✔ How to design secure and compliant voice agents using Azure’s shared responsibility model ✔ How multilingual conversations work in real time ✔ How R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) helps the agent answer from documents, menus, or PDFs ✔ How transcription, analytics, and cost tracking can be enabled for call reporting ✔ How to integrate with Power Automate, CRM systems, and APIs ✔ How to make the AI smart enough to escalate to a human when needed By the end, you’ll know whether Azure AI Voice Agents are ready to replace traditional call centres and how to build one step-by-step. 🔹 Tools Used: Azure OpenAI Realtime API, Azure Communication Services, Azure AI Speech, Azure AI Search, Azure Key Vault, Power Automate 🔹 Ideal For: AI developers, cloud architects, startups, and businesses exploring AI-powered customer communication Stay tuned till the end — I’ll also share cost details and tips on designing secure, enterprise-ready AI voice solutions on Azure.
